In this video, you will be introduced to Enterprise H2O GPTe, a versatile platform that integrates various Large Language Models (LLMs), both commercial and open-source.
We will demonstrate key features, including the ability to chat with different LLMs and leverage the powerful Retrieval-Augmented Generation (RAG) capability.
This feature allows you to upload documents, websites, or even audio files (which are transcribed into documents) and extract information through interactive chats with the tool.

Upon familiarising ourselves with the fundamentals, we now explore the advanced capabilities of H2O GPTe, focusing on the use of Collections for document management and querying.
You will learn how to upload various sources of information, including web pages, and query them using Large Language Models (LLMs).
Once again, we will demonstrate this by importing the Hamilton Wikipedia page and querying it to retrieve detailed information.
Discover how Collections can transform and store text in a vector database, enabling more precise and informed responses from LLMs.
In this video, we highlight the reference capability of H2O GPTe when querying documents within Collections.
You will learn how the tool provides specific references for information sourced from web pages.
We will query the First Act of the Hamilton play and compare responses from using the RAG model versus the standalone LLM. Understand how using RAG provides detailed, sourced information while the standalone LLM gives more generic responses.
